What Is a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a medical doctor who focuses on diagnosing and treating mental health conditions but runs independently of the NHS. These specialists typically have comprehensive experience and might offer services such as treatment, medication management, and even occupational therapy. Private psychiatrists can provide a variety of services customized to specific needs, which often translates into a more tailored technique to mental healthcare.

If you decide to pursue treatment through a private psychiatrist, the process generally involves several steps:
Initial Consultation: This is usually an extensive session where the psychiatrist assesses your mental health history, current condition, and treatment goals.
Diagnosis: Based on the consultation and any required assessments, the psychiatrist will supply a diagnosis if suitable.
Treatment Plan: Together with the psychiatrist, you'll establish a tailored treatment strategy that details treatment sessions, medications, and additional support.
Follow-Up Sessions: Regular follow-ups will be scheduled to keep track of progress and make any needed adjustments to the treatment strategy.
Continuous Support: Many psychiatrists offer ongoing assistance and check-ins, which are crucial for long-lasting healing and well-being.
FAQ about Private Psychiatrists in the UK1. How much does it cost to see a private psychiatrist in the UK?
Costs can vary considerably depending on the psychiatrist's experience and location. Usually, an assessment can range from ₤ 150 to ₤ 350 per session.
2. Will my insurance cover private psychiatric treatment?
Some health insurance policies do cover private psychiatric treatment. It's necessary to check your policy and clarify any concerns with the insurance provider.
